Transaction 4f8291d628289ca0a5ce66023299e0ebe2581aece5416884c974759385801aea
1 Input
1 Output
-
4f8291d628289ca0a5ce66023299e0ebe2581aece5416884c974759385801aea:0
- value
- 19878
- script pubkey
- OP_0 OP_PUSHBYTES_32 abed7aab3f3e7142aa89f7b5aac1374e36756cb2dbc4447a7bc6bdffcbc23de6
- address
- bc1q40kh42el8ec5925f77664sfhfcm82m9jm0zyg7nmc67llj7z8hnqhyjls4